2 Chronicles 18:30
Now the king of Syria had commanded the captains of the chariots that were with him, saying, Fight ye not with small or great, save only with the king of Israel.
KJV
Rex autem Syriæ præceperat ducibus equitatus sui, dicens : Ne pugnetis contra minimum aut contra maximum, nisi contra solum regem Israël.
Vulgate
καὶ βασιλεὺς Συρίας ἐνετείλατο τοῖς ἄρχουσιν τῶν ἁρμάτων τοῖς μετ’ αὐτοῦ λέγων Μὴ πολεμεῖτε τὸν μικρὸν καὶ τὸν μέγαν ἀλλ’ ἢ τὸν βασιλέα Ἰσραὴλ μόνον.
LXX
Now the king of Syria had commanded the captains of his chariots, saying, Fight neither with small nor great, save only with the king of Israel.
ASV
